For a Broken-hearted Poet

Let words say what they say;
let them lay on the page as your soul pored them.
that was the state of your soul:
broken, hurt, limping among
the rubble of your heart.
But ruins are not a place to dwell. They are lessons, and
a tragedy made of crumbled hopes and vanished dreams. let
the ruins lie: Yours is the good earth,
rich with black soil, where a new hope might arise again.

— For Roger.
